Step 1: Assessing the Damage
Our team begins by evaluating the source and extent of the water damage, taking note of any affected areas and the type of water involved (gray, black, or clear). This critical step helps us develop an effective plan to extract the water and dry the area.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to extract the standing water, working quickly to prevent further damage and moisture buildup. Our equipment is designed to handle even the largest water damage jobs, ensuring a thorough extraction process.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Following water extraction, our team applies a combination of drying and dehumidification techniques to remove any remaining moisture from the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ring a safe, healthy environment.
Step 4: Monitoring and Verification
Our technicians closely monitor the affected area to ensure that all moisture has been removed and the space is dry to the touch. This final step confirms that your home is safe from further water damage and mold growth.

Warning Signs You Need Standing Water Extraction
Ignoring the warning signs of standing water in your home can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. Keep an eye out for these common indicators: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A persistent, unpleasant smell in your home could be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th. Don’t ignore it, address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Water damage can cause your flooring to become warped, buckled, or discolored. If you notice any of these signs, it’s likely that there’s a larger issue at play.
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Visible water stains on your walls or ceilings are a clear indication that water damage has occurred. Address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.
Unexplained Water Bills
An unexpected spike in your water bill could be a sign of a hidden water leak or issue. Investigate the matter quickly to prevent further waste and damage.
Visible Water Damage on Furniture or Belongings
Water damage can ruin your furniture, clothing, and other belongings. If you notice any signs of water damage, act quickly to prevent further loss.
Unpleasant Odors or Slime
A strong, unpleasant odor or visible slime in your home could be a sign of mold growth. Don’t ignore it, address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and health hazards.

How long does it take to complete a Standing Water Extraction job?
The duration of a Standing Water Extraction job can vary depending on the size and complexity of the job. Typically, our technicians can complete a job within 3-5 days, but this can range from a few hours to several days in more complex cases.

Do I need to replace my flooring or walls after a Standing Water Extraction job?
It depends on the extent of the damage. If the water damage is minor, we may be able to restore your flooring or walls to their original condition. But, in cases of severe damage, replacement may be necessary to prevent further damage and ensure a safe living environment.
